L&D Teams' Challenges

The Report reveals that L&D and HR professionals are grappling with significant challenges. Chief among these are balancing workload with learning opportunities and measuring the return on investment (ROI) for learning programs. Many organizations also struggle with aligning learning initiatives to broader business goals while facing budget constraints.

Employees' Challenges

From the employees’ perspective, engaging meaningfully with learning programs is hampered by real-world barriers. Limited time and inadequate resources remain the foremost obstacles to participation. Employees also cite difficulties in adapting to new learning technologies and balancing work-life-learning demands.

Developmental Goal for L&D Teams

L&D teams are setting ambitious developmental goals for 2025. Needs assessment and fostering a continuous learning culture rank high on the list of priorities. There is also a strong emphasis on leadership development and ensuring that learning initiatives are closely aligned with business strategy.

General Aspiration

Looking forward, organizations are united in their aspiration to build future-ready workforces. Continuous learning cultures and accelerated reskilling/upskilling initiatives are central to these ambitions. Additionally, organizations are embracing AI-powered personalization, and data-driven learning insights.
